A fast-absorbing gel designed to help maintain balance in skin tone and texture, replacing dullness with refreshed vitality.

Benefits:
Promotes skin renewal to diminish uneven tones.
Helps regulate sebum production for a clearer complexion.
Enhances hydration without leaving a greasy residue.
Soothes irritation and calms redness.
Refreshes skin with a light, cooling sensation.

Main Ingredients & Their Benefits:
Propylene Glycol: A humectant that draws moisture deeper into skin, enhances absorption of active ingredients, contributes to gel consistency.
- Cucumis Melo (Melon) Fruit Extract: Contains catalase and superoxide dismutase (SOD) — powerful antioxidants that help neutralize free radicals, protect melanocytes, and restore oxidative balance in the epidermis.
